回答編集履歴
1
誤記訂正
answer
CHANGED
@@ -6,13 +6,13 @@
|
|
6
6
|
|
7
7
|
ということろで Web API から Ab クラスのコレクション List<Ab> というデータを取得する部分までは完成しているのですか?
|
8
8
|
|
9
|
-
そして、例えば、 List<Ab> の中に 2 つ Ab クラスのオブジェクトがあって、その Id がそれぞれ "1234", "1112" だった場合(あくまで例えばの話です)、mappings ディクショナリの中で key がそれに該当する kamoku クラスの Id = "10000", Name = "国語" と Id = "10000", Name = "理科" を View に表示するという理解で正しいですか?
|
9
|
+
そして、例えば、 List<Ab> の中に 2 つ Ab クラスのオブジェクトがあって、その Id がそれぞれ "1234", "1112" だった場合(あくまで例えばの話です)、mappings ディクショナリの中で key がそれに該当する kamoku クラスの中身すなわち Id = "10000", Name = "国語" と Id = "10000", Name = "理科" を View に表示するという理解で正しいですか?
|
10
10
|
|
11
11
|
その理解で正しければ、プリミティブに foreach を使って(Linq とか使ってもっとスマートにできるかもしれませんが、とりあえずそれは置いといて)以下のように kamoku クラスのコレクションを作って、それを Model として View に渡すというのはいかがですか?
|
12
12
|
|
13
13
|
```
|
14
14
|
List<Ab> list = (List<Ab>)serializer3.Deserialize(res3); // 変数名を list に変えました
|
15
|
-
List<
|
15
|
+
List<Kamoku> result = new List<Kamoku>();
|
16
16
|
|
17
17
|
foreach (Ab item in list)
|
18
18
|
{
|